Skip to content

Commit 3d6aaff

Browse files
committed
Address review comments.
1 parent 90cfd4e commit 3d6aaff

File tree

6 files changed

+221
-163
lines changed

6 files changed

+221
-163
lines changed

.mypy.ini

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,3 +3,6 @@ check_untyped_defs = True
33

44
[mypy-ansible.*]
55
ignore_missing_imports = True
6+
7+
[mypy-yamllint.*]
8+
ignore_missing_imports = True

.yamllint

Lines changed: 58 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,58 @@
1+
---
2+
extends: default
3+
4+
rules:
5+
line-length:
6+
max: 160
7+
level: warning
8+
document-start:
9+
# present: true
10+
level: warning
11+
document-end:
12+
# present: false
13+
level: warning
14+
truthy:
15+
level: warning
16+
allowed-values:
17+
- 'true'
18+
- 'false'
19+
indentation:
20+
level: warning
21+
spaces: 2
22+
indent-sequences: consistent
23+
key-duplicates:
24+
level: warning
25+
forbid-duplicated-merge-keys: true
26+
trailing-spaces: enable
27+
hyphens:
28+
max-spaces-after: 1
29+
level: warning
30+
empty-lines:
31+
max: 2
32+
max-start: 0
33+
max-end: 0
34+
level: warning
35+
commas:
36+
max-spaces-before: 0
37+
min-spaces-after: 1
38+
max-spaces-after: 1
39+
level: warning
40+
colons:
41+
max-spaces-before: 0
42+
max-spaces-after: 1
43+
level: warning
44+
brackets:
45+
min-spaces-inside: 0
46+
max-spaces-inside: 0
47+
level: warning
48+
braces:
49+
min-spaces-inside: 0
50+
max-spaces-inside: 1
51+
level: warning
52+
octal-values:
53+
forbid-implicit-octal: true
54+
forbid-explicit-octal: true
55+
level: warning
56+
comments:
57+
min-spaces-from-content: 1
58+
level: warning

noxfile.py

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-15,6 +15,7 @@
1515
"hacking/tagger/tag.py",
1616
"noxfile.py",
1717
*iglob("docs/bin/*.py"),
18+
*iglob("tests/checkers/rst-yamllint*.py"), # TODO: also lint others
1819
)
1920
PINNED = os.environ.get("PINNED", "true").lower() in {"1", "true"}
2021
nox.options.sessions = ("clone-core", "lint", "checkers", "make")

0 commit comments

Comments
 (0)